About Laurence Devoto

Laurence Devoto is a scholar working on Surgery, Oncology,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ging and Biomedical Engineering, having authored 8 papers that have together received 254 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Colorectal Cancer Surgical Treatments (3 papers), Pancreatic and Hepatic Oncology Research (2 papers), Surgical Simulation and Training (2 papers), Head and Neck Surgical Oncology (1 paper), Genetic factors in colorectal cancer (1 paper), Anatomy and Medical Technology (1 paper), Augmented Reality Applications (1 paper) and Pneumothorax, Barotrauma, Emphysema (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Oncology (143 citations), Geriatrics and Gerontology (14 citations),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ging (61 citations),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ine (55 citations) and Surgery (104 citations). Laurence Devoto has collaborated with scholars based in United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include Richard Cohen, Manish Chand, Valerio Celentano, Jim Khan, Manish Chand, Deborah S. Keller, David T. Delpy, Manuel Rodriguez‐Justo, Ilias Tachtsidis and Clare E. Elwell. Their work appears in journals such as Advances in experimental medicine and biology, Journal of Fluorescence, JAMA Surgery, Techniques in Coloproctology and International Journal of Colorectal Disease.
